[Waterloo-Cedar Falls Courier, Sunday, April 15, 2007]

WATERLOO - Ruthe E. Lamb, 96, of Waterloo, died Thursday, April 12, 2007, at Windsor Nursing and Rehab Center.

She was born July 27, 1910, in Lucas County, daughter of William and Mabel Lyman Blanchard. She married Myron Lamb on Oct. 17, 1929, in Waterloo. He preceded her in death on Aug. 17, 1997.

Mrs. Lamb worked as a cashier for the Black's Department Store for 25 years, retiring in 1973.

Survived by a son, Calvin (Marlys) of Waterloo; seven grandchildren; 14 great-grandchildren; and six great-great-grandchildren.

Preceded in death by a daughter, Ruth Kay Hemmer; three brothers, Gerald, Edwin and Lyman Blanchard; and two sisters, Jane Mahoney and Evelyn Spindler.

Memorial services: 11 a.m. Tuesday at Hammond Avenue Brethren Church, with burial before the service at 10 a.m. in the mausoleum in the Garden of Memories Cemetery. Public visitation from 4 to 7 p.m. Monday at the Kearns, Huisman-Schumacher Chapel on Kimball.

Memorials may be directed to the church or the family.
